Morigny-Champigny (French pronunciation: [mɔʁiɲi ʃɑ̃piɲi] (
listen)) is a commune in the Essonne department in Île-de-France in northern France.

Inhabitants of Morigny-Champigny are known as Morignacois.
The village lies on the right bank of the Juine, which flows northward through the western part of the commune.
